Invesco Ltd., founded in 1978 and head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ia, is a global investment management firm managing hundreds of billions in assets across a diverse range of products, including mutual funds, exchange-traded funds (ETFs), and institutional portfolios. Known for its blend of active and passive investment strategies, Invesco serves individual investors, financial advisors, and institutions, with a strong presence in North America, Europe, and Asia, bolstered by acquisitions like OppenheimerFunds in 2019. The firm offers specialized solutions in equities, fixed income, real estate, and alternatives, leveraging its global research capabilities to cater to varying market needs. Invesco’s commitment to innovation and client-focused investing has solidified its reputation as a versatile player in the asset management industry.

Invesco's Q3 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2025, Invesco held 3,874 positions worth $635B, up 7.9% from $588B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 21% of the portfolio.

Invesco's Q3 2025 filing shows 120 new, 1,999 increased, 1,571 reduced and 91 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Paramount Skydance Corp: 15,251,112 shares worth $289M. The largest sale was HEICO Corp Class A, an estimated $1.46B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 28% of assets, up from 26%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Industrials.
